Question: A hydronic heating system is installed in a building at an elevation of 100 metres above sea level. The boiler is located in the basement, 3 metres below the lowest heating terminal. What is the minimum cold fill pressure (static pressure) required at the boiler to ensure adequate pressure at the highest point of the system?
Answer options: ✅ 30 kPa (4.4 psi)
- 60 kPa (8.7 psi)
- 90 kPa (13.1 psi)
- 120 kPa (17.4 psi)
Correct answer: 30 kPa (4.4 psi)
Explanation: The minimum cold fill pressure must be sufficient to overcome the static head of the highest point in the system. For every 1 metre of height, approximately 10 kPa of pressure is required. Therefore, for a 3-metre static head, a minimum of 30 kPa (3m x 10kPa/m = 30 kPa) is needed. This ensures water reaches the top of the system and provides a slight positive pressure to prevent air ingress.
